What Are the Challenges Associated with Perforated Plates in Catalysis?

Despite their benefits, there are challenges in using perforated plates in catalysis:
Clogging: The holes can get clogged with reaction by-products, reducing efficiency.
Pressure Drop: The presence of holes can sometimes cause a pressure drop, affecting the flow of reactants and products.
Mechanical Stability: Ensuring that the plate maintains its structural integrity under extreme conditions can be challenging.
